반응형 비주얼스튜디오2 [C# 개발] 파이썬 없이 엑셀 업무 자동화하기: OpenXML로 엑셀 파일 읽고 쓰기 가이드 직장인들의 업무 효율을 높여주는 '업무 자동화'라고 하면 흔히 파이썬(Python)을 떠올리지만, C# 개발자라면 익숙한 Visual Studio 환경에서 훨씬 더 강력하고 안정적인 자동화 툴을 만들 수 있습니다. 특히 MS Office가 설치되지 않은 환경에서도 동작하고 속도가 매우 빠른 OpenXML SDK를 활용하면, 대용량 엑셀 데이터 처리도 문제없습니다. 오늘은 C#으로 엑셀 자동화의 기초를 다지는 핵심 코드를 정리해 드립니다.1. 왜 엑셀 라이브러리(Interop)를 쓰지 않나요?과거에는 Microsoft.Office.Interop.Excel을 많이 썼지만, 이는 속도가 느리고 서버 환경이나 오피스 미설치 PC에서 오류가 잦습니다. 반면 OpenXML은 엑셀 파일을 XML 구조로 직접 핸들링하.. 2026. 3. 30. [C# 개발 팁] 비주얼 스튜디오(Visual Studio) 빌드 속도 답답할 때? 5분 만에 최적화하기 C#이나 .NET 프로젝트를 진행하다 보면, 코드 몇 줄 고치고 빌드(Build) 버튼을 눌렀을 때의 그 지루한 대기 시간이 개발 흐름을 끊곤 합니다.특히 프로젝트 규모가 커질수록 빌드 속도는 생산성과 직결되는 문제입니다. 오늘은 엔지니어 관점에서 비주얼 스튜디오의 빌드 속도를 2배 이상 끌어올릴 수 있는 핵심 최적화 설정 3가지를 정리해 드립니다. 사소한 설정 하나가 여러분의 퇴근 시간을 앞당겨줄 것입니다.1. 하드웨어 가속 및 병렬 빌드 설정 확인비주얼 스튜디오는 다중 코어 프로세서를 활용하여 여러 프로젝트를 동시에 빌드할 수 있습니다.이 설정이 제대로 되어 있지 않으면 고사양 PC라도 제 성능을 내지 못합니다. [도구] -> [옵션] -> [프로젝트 및 솔루션] -> [빌드 및 실행]으로 이동합니.. 2026. 3. 23. 이전 1 다음 반응형